  <abstract>For several decades now, forest issues have been the focus of interest and concern  of environmentalists and conservationist, due to its vital importance. These ecologically,  biotically and complex ecosystem, which is the richest area on earth is steadily shrinking.  Several resolution and attempt are made to save these resources like the establishment of  National Parks. However, National Parks are not a complete guarantee that these forests  will be left undisturbed due to natural forces and factors beyond control. Thus, this study  was made possible, to assess the status of forest resources in the National Parks in  Thailand using Multi temporal NOAA A VHRR. The Normalized Vegetation Index  (NDVI) was utilized to determine the vegetation status. Meanwhile, Becker and Li  equation based on the split window technique was used to obtain the Land Surface  Temperature (LST). These two parameters were used in the Model developed, which is  based on Matrix Method. The study shows that there is a very high correlation  coefficient between LST Nighttime and the actual ground surface temperature  measurement. Furthermore, there is an inverse relationship between NDVI and LST.  The Model developed was proven effective in identifying the status of forest resources  for the dry season. </abstract>
